Focus on ... Wimbledon

Crack open the Pimm's, it's time for that very British show of optimism - following 'Tiger' Tim Henman through the tournament. - The 2003 men's singles winner, Roger Federer, is top seed this year. - Last year's women's singles title winner, Serena Williams, has confirmed she will compete this year, having recovered from a knee injury. In her time away from tennis, she has launched a clothing range and signed a £21.8m sponsorship deal with Nike.

- Henman, now 29, will be taking part in his 11th Championships. He has reached the semi-final four times.
